Van Buren is a village located in Hancock County, Ohio. Van Buren has a 2026 population of 400. Van Buren is currently growing at a rate of 0.25% annually and its population has increased by 0.76%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 397 in 2020.
The median household income in Van Buren is $87,216 with a poverty rate of 11.84%. The median age in Van Buren is 37.4 years: 35 years for males, and 41.9 years for females. For every 100 females there are 118.4 males.
